Mulampazham availability is lesser in bazar comparing to Krishani, anothervariety, slightly different in skin appearance and internal flesh is hard in it.Mulampazham flush is not hard and slightly more sweet. Most probably cool drinks stalls procure mulampazham more. Mulampazhamcannot be stored on groundas a heap, like watermelon since due to weight of the melon above,bottom one may break. In Kerala though summer is like in Tamilnadu, sometimes more, stillgetting vellaripinchu, tender cucumber, mulampazham etc. were difficult while Iwas in Trivandrum. The reason is the low glycemic load of this fruit which is only 3.14. 5 Origin of musk melon The origin of melons is not known. Research has revealed that seeds androotstocks were among the goods traded along the caravan routes of the AncientWorld. Some botanistsconsider melons native to the Levant and Egypt, while others placetheir origin in Iran, India or Central Asia.Still others support an Africanorigin, and in modern times wild melons can still be found in some Africancountries 6 Background The melon is an annual, trailing herb. It grows well in subtropical orwarm, temperate climates. Melons prefer warm, well-fertilized soil with gooddrainage that is rich in nutrients, but are vulnerable to downy mildew andanthracnose. Melons are monoecious plants. They do not cross with watermelon,cucumber, pumpkin, or squash, but varieties within the species intercrossfrequently. The genome of Cucumis melo was first sequenced in 2012. 7 Uses In addition to their consumption when fresh, melons are sometimes dried.Other varieties arecooked, or grown for their seeds, which are processed to produce melon oil. Still other varietiesare grown only for their pleasant fragrance. The Japanese liqueur, Midori, isflavored with melon. 8 History There is debate among scholars whether the abattiach in The Book ofNumbers 11:5 refers to a melon or a watermelon. Both types of melon were known in Ancient Egypt andother settled areas. Some botanists consider melons native to theLevant and Egypt, while others place the origin in Persia, India or CentralAsia, thus the origin is uncertain. Melon was domesticated in West Asiaand over time manycultivars developed with variety in shape and sweetness. Iran, India,Uzbekistan, Afghanistan and China become centers for melon production. 9 Some miscellaneous information. Muskmelon has a ribbed, tan skin and a sweet, musky flavor and aroma.Overthe years, many unique varieties of muskmelon have emerged, includingcantaloupe.Muskmelon is delicious, refreshing, and easy to add to your diet.Itcan be cut into cubes and enjoyed alone or as part of a tasty fruit salad. Itcan also be churned into a fresh sorbet for a healthy way to satisfy your sweettooth. Additionally, you can add this nutritious melon to salads or smoothiesfor a burst of extra flavor and nutrition.What’s more, you can wash, dry, androast the seeds of muskmelon for a satisfying snack. Alternatively, trysprinkling them over soups and salads. 10 SUMMARY The flesh and seeds of muskmelon can be enjoyed in many ways in maindishes, desserts, and snacks alike.
